FRANCE - Camaieu sold to Cinven
AXA Private Equity will sell its controlling shareholding in clothing brand Camaïeu to Cinven, at a unitary share price of EUR 267. The offer values the target at EUR 1.6bn.
Following the deal, in accordance with market regulations, Cinven will launch a tender offer for the remainder of the shares.
Camaïeu generated sales of EUR 552m in 2006 with an EBIT of EUR 81m.
